Adam Ford:
|Using the 'cdcontrol' program, running it by typing cdcontrol -f
|/dev/wcd0a [tried wcd0c/wcd1a/wcd1c too, and made the devices].
|
|I try and type play 01 This gives back :
|cdcontrol: Input/output error
...
|Ummmm, any more ideas?
|
|I'm all out, and I've run out of hair now!! ;)
|
|Any ideas greatly appreciated, I've just subscribed to this list, so
|hopefully I'll get the reply :)
You want:
cdcontrol -f /dev/rwcd0c
for workman, you want:
workman -c /dev/rwcd0c -b
